ALBRECHTSEN joined Albion from FC Copenhagen in June 2004 for a then-club record £2.7million transfer fee, signing a three-year deal plus a year's option in the club's favour

After struggling to hold down a place at centre-half and left-back during his first few months as an Albion player, the jet-heeled defender was surprisingly slotted in at right-back by Bryan Robson and went on to play a vital part in the Baggies' Great Escape of 2004/05.

During 2005/06, he faced stiff competition for his position from new recruit Steve Watson but still went on to make 35 appearances, coming off the bench to score his first Baggies goal in a 1-0 win at Wigan in January 2006.

It was more of the same for Albrechtsen during 2006/07. He featured regularly during the first half of the season but had to play second fiddle from the turn of the year to Paul McShane.

After joining from local rivals AB, Albrechtsen spent two-and-half years at FC Copenhagen, where he helped the Danish giants win and retain the Danish Super League title in his final two seasons at the club, winning the domestic double in 2003/04.

Albrechtsen earned the last of his three full Denmark caps against Bosnia & Herzegovina in 2003 and played alongside another of Albion's recent Danish imports, Thomas Gaardsoe, at Under-21 level.

He has also appeared in several 'unofficial' international friendlies, including January 2004's 1-1 draw against USA.
